Further Information

Bioactivity:
AZ5576 is a potent and highly selective CDK9 inhibitor. AZ5576 can be used for the research of Hematological Malignancy [1].
CAS:
2751721-40-9
Molecular Weight:
385.43
Pathway:
Cell Cycle/Checkpoint
Purity:
1
SMILES:
O(C)C1=C(C=2C=C(NC(=O)[C@@H]3C[C@H](NC(C)=O)CCC3)N=CC2)C=CC(F)=C1
Target:
CDK
